Pearl Unbroken: A Vision of the Philippines Without Colonization

What if the Philippines had never been colonized? What if the rich kingdoms, sultanates, and confederations that once thrived across the archipelago had united, repelled foreign invaders, and forged their own destiny?
Pearl Unbroken: A Vision of the Philippines Without Colonization is an alternate history that reimagines a world where Maharlika-the land of Rajahs, Sultans, and Lakans-rose to power on its own terms. In this vividly reimagined past, the Philippines stands as a sovereign empire, a thriving center of trade, scholarship, and diplomacy, unshackled by the weight of colonial conquest. From the bustling port of Tundok to the fortified palaces of Mindanao, the story unfolds in a world where indigenous governance, maritime dominance, and cultural brilliance shape an unbroken civilization.
